Technical Context
The IRFI720G employs a third-generation silicon process optimized for ruggedized avalanche operation and fast dynamic dV/dt immunity (4.0 V/ns). Its TO-220 FULLPAK construction integrates a molded isolating barrier equivalent to a 100 µm mica sheet, enabling direct heatsink mounting without insulating hardware.
It features low thermal resistance (RthJC = 4.1 °C/W), supports repetitive avalanche energy up to 3.0 mJ, and exhibits body diode reverse recovery time of 300–600 ns with Qrr = 1.5–3.0 µC-critical for hard-switched flyback and forward converter topologies.

Pinout & Package
IRFI720G uses the TO-220 FULLPAK package: isolated metal tab (drain-connected), 3-pin through-hole outline with 2.54 mm lead pitch, 15.87 mm length, and 10.1 mm width. The molded compound provides 4.8 mm creepage between sink and leads.
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| Drain (Tab) | Main current path output / heatsink interface | Electrically isolated but thermally coupled; requires no insulator when mounted to heatsink. |
| Source | Reference node for gate drive and current sensing | Low-inductance source connection essential for stable switching and accurate IS monitoring. |
| Gate | Control input for channel conduction | Requires ≤±20 V drive; 3.3 nC Qgs enables fast turn-on with moderate gate resistor values. |

FAQ
What is the maximum continuous drain current for the IRFI720G at 100 °C case temperature?
The IRFI720G supports 1.7 A continuous drain current at TC = 100 °C, as specified in the Absolute Maximum Ratings table. This derating reflects thermal limits of the TO-220 FULLPAK package and ensures safe operation without exceeding 150 °C junction temperature. Designers must verify heatsink performance to maintain TC ≤ 100 °C under full load when using IRFI720G in sustained conduction modes.
Does the IRFI720G require an insulating pad when mounted to a heatsink?
No-the IRFI720G does not require an insulating pad because its TO-220 FULLPAK package incorporates a molded isolation barrier rated at 2.5 kVRMS. The metal tab is electrically isolated from the leads while maintaining low thermal resistance (RthJC = 4.1 °C/W). This allows direct screw or clip mounting to grounded heatsinks in industrial equipment without additional insulation hardware-reducing assembly cost and thermal interface resistance.
What is the gate-source threshold voltage range for the IRFI720G?
The IRFI720G has a gate-source threshold voltage (VGS(th)) range of 2.0 V to 4.0 V at TJ = 25 °C and ID = 250 µA. This ensures reliable turn-on with standard 5 V or 10 V logic-level gate drivers while providing noise margin against false triggering. The specification is confirmed in the Static Characteristics section of the Vishay datasheet S21-0974-Rev. D, and applies directly to the IRFI720G part number.
Can the IRFI720G be used in avalanche mode repeatedly?
Yes-the IRFI720G is rated for repetitive avalanche operation with IAR = 2.6 A and EAR = 3.0 mJ, provided pulse width and duty cycle remain within limits defined by junction temperature rise. This capability is validated per test condition b in the datasheet and makes IRFI720G suitable for inductive load switching in motor controls and solenoid drivers where external clamping is impractical.
What is the typical body diode reverse recovery time for the IRFI720G?
The IRFI720G exhibits a typical body diode reverse recovery time (trr) of 300 ns, with a maximum of 600 ns at TJ = 25 °C, IF = 3.3 A, and dI/dt = 100 A/µs. This value is measured per the test circuit in Figure 12b and is critical for estimating commutation losses in freewheeling paths. Designers should account for trr and Qrr = 1.5–3.0 µC when selecting gate resistors and snubbers for IRFI720G-based topologies.
